Buddhadharma or Buddhism, as it is widely known today, was founded over 2500 years ago in ancient India by the historical Buddha, Shakyamuni. After attaining realization in approximately 531 B.C.E., the Buddha taught widely until his passing in approximately 486 B.C.E tibetan historians hold that by the time of his passing, the Buddha had taught the whole corpus of Buddhist teachings,  encompassing what came to be known as the three major vehicles (Skt. yanas), or cycles of the Buddhist teachings. Hinayana, Mahayana and Vajrayana . Each of these cycles of teaching became popular at different periods in the history of Buddhism.

Architecture Tour of India
 
 
Duration : 17 Nights / 18 Days
Destinations Covered : Mumbai - Hyderabad - Chennai -Bangalore - Mysore - Belur & Helebid - Ahmedabad - Udaipur - Jaipur - Agra - Khajuraho - Delhi

Seven Wonder of The World Taj MahalThis tour is specially designed to see the amazing workmanship of few of the most famous monuments of India. The Gateway of India built during the British Rule in India, Museums, The splendid Char Minar of Hyderabad which is known as city of Nawab's, The magnificent Vidhan Sabha of Bangalore, Temples of Belur and Helebid which are exquisite specimen of Hoysala Art, Qutab Minar in Delhi which is a perfect example of Persian art in India, Kamasutra Temples of Khajuraho, Royal Forts and Palaces of Rajasthan and mesmerizing Taj Mahal which is perhaps the most beautiful monument ever built in the history of love, are few of the highlights of this tour.

Day 01 : Arrive Mumbai
Upon arrival at Mumbai International airport the representative of Max Holidays will welcome you and transfer you to your hotel for night stay.

Day 02 : Mumbai sightseeing
Breakfast will be in the hotel and later our tour guide will take you to the tour of Mumbai city. In the morning visit Elephanta Island by motor launch (Located 10 kms away from Mumbai land, the Elephanta Island Caves consist of temples carved from rock which date back to the 7th century) Visit Gateway of India (This symbolicnational landmark, the Marble arch of India, designed by George Wittet to commemorate the visit of George V and Queen Mary in 1911), Princess of Wales Museum (This museum has a priceless collection of art, sculpture, china and other antics. Carefully presereved, this mid-Victorian Gothic style building built in 1904 with beautiful gardens surrounding it), Kamla Nehru Park and Hanging Gardens (One gets a panoramic view of parts of the city from the separks situated at the height of Malabar Hill.), Chowpati Beach. Eveningdrive through Marine Drive (One of the most beautiful and picturesque driving lane in the city). Night stay will be in the hotel.

Day 03 : Mumbai - Hyderabad by flight
Great Architecture Char Minar Hyderabad !!!After breakfast you will betransferred to the airport to board your flight to Hyderabad (Hyderabad isan important centre of Islamic culture, was the seat of the legendary Nizams of Hyderabad, rulers of one of the largest native states in India). In Hyderabad transfer to your hotel for check in. Afternoon sightseeing of the city visiting High Court Building (built in solid pink granite. It is a very impressive building in Mughal - Saracenic style, enriched with panels of bas-relief decoration carved in red Agra sandstone), Char Minar (186 feet high and 100 feet wide on each frontage this is a master piece of the Qutb Shahi dynasty and was intended to mark the centre of the city), Mecca Masjid (One of the largest mosques in the country. The small red stones in the central arch are made of earth from Mecca) and Archaeological Museum. Nightstay in the hotel.

Day 04 : Excursion to Golkonda Fort
Today after breakfast our tour guide will take you on an excursion to Golkonda Fort (Golconda was the centre of arich and powerful state formed on the disintegration of the Bahmani kingdomin the early 16th century. It is of outstanding interest for both its fortand the royal tombs, which represents the third and final phase of the Deccan style of Islamic architecture. The Fort lies about 8.5 kilometres west of Hyderabad on an isolated granite hill. The Royal Tombs of Golconda contain the entire dynasty with the exception of two who died in exile. They form a fascinating collection of Islamic funerary architecture. On selected evenings, Golconda Fort has interesting attraction in the form of Sound & Light Show which is available for the visitors at extra charges mainly during the winter season). Night stay in your hotel.

Day 05 : Hyderabad - Chennai by flight
Saint Mary's Church Chennai !!!After breakfast we transfer you to the airport to board flight to Chennai (Madras). In Chennai transfer to your hotel. Later half day tour of the city with our guide visiting Saint Mary's Church (The spiritual and physical centre of the original settlement and the oldest surviving building in the East associated with the Anglican church), St. George Fort (Built in 1644 the fort lies on the sea shore immediately north of the island. This now forms the nucleus of the Secretariat) and Museum (The museum house a fantastic collection of medieval artillery, regimental flags, weapons and armour). Night stay in the hotel.

Day 06 : Excursion to Mahabalipuram & Kanchipuram
This morning our guide will take you to a day trip to Mahabalipuram (The rock-cut and monolithic temples at Mahabalipuram are the earliest temples of monumental architecture in Southern India. Most of the cave temples are excavated into the sides of agranite hill, only a short distance from the sea. Shore temple at Mahabalipuram is the first significant structural temple of the Pallava period dating back to the 8th century) and Kanchipuram (Examples of Hindu temple architecture spanning almost a thousand years are preserved at kanchipuram & Mahabalipuram Huge Temple Tour !!!Kanchipuram). Evening back to Chennai for night stay in your hotel.

Day 07 : Chennai - Bangalore by flight
After breakfast we take you to the airport to board flight to Bangalore. Uopn arrival check into the hotel.Later sightseeing of Bangalore city with our guide visiting Lal Baghbotanical garden, Vidhan Sabha (A huge neo-Dravidian granite building which houses the secretariat and the state legislative. It is one of the most impressive modern buildings in India) and Bull Temple. Night stay in your hotel

Day 08 : Bangalore - Belur - Helebid - Mysore
After breakfast we drive to Mysore fora night trip. On the way we visit Chennakeshava temple at Belur (Entirelybuilt of grey - green chloride, Chennakeshava temple is one of the early master pieces of the Hoysala period) and Hoysaleshvara temple at Helebid (Representing the Hoysala style, Hoysaleshvara temple is renowned for its architecturally and artistically). Proceed to Mysore and check into the hotel for night stay.

Day 09 : Mysore - Bangalore drive and Bangalore - Ahmedabad by flight
Nandi Bull Temple Bangalore !!!After breakfast sightseeing of Mysore (Once the capital of Wodeyar kingdom, Mysore is a blend of palaces, temples and gardens and still known as one of the finest cities of southern India) visit Art Gallery, Chamundi Hill and Nandi Bull. Later drive back to Bangalore airport via Srirangapatanam Fort (Srirangapatanam is renowned as the capital of Mysore Rulers - Haider Ali and Tipu Sultan and also known forthe bloody struggles against the British in the late 18th century). In Bangalore direct transfer to the airport to board flight to Ahmedabad. Transfer and night stay at Ahmedabad.

Day 10 : Ahmedabad
After breakfast our tour guide will take you for a tour of Ahmedabad city which was founded in 1411 by AhmedShah, Ahmedabad in Gujarat is today known for its fine Islamic monuments with their Indo - Sarcenic styles of architecture. The tour will include a visit to Jami Mosque, (The mosque lies in the center of the city and most of the part of the mosque was destroyed in 1819 due to earth quake), Shakingminarets (Opposite the large gate of Sarangpur Darwaja, Sidi Bashir's minarsare all that remain of the mosque popularly named Heritage Art work in Ranakpur Temple Tour !!!after one of Ahmed Shah's favourite slaves.), Gandhi Ashram (Gandhiji's Sabarmati Ashram displays the Mahatma's letters and possessions, along with a powerful collection of photographs of his years of fighting for freedom) and Museum of Textiles (The museum has the finest collection of textiles, clothes, furniture,temple artifacts and crafts in the country). Night stay in the hotel at Ahmedabad

Day 11 : Ahmedabad - Udaipur
After breakfast we drive to the romantic city of Udaipur, Rajasthan. Upon arrival check into the hotel. Afternoon visit City Palace Museum, Sahelion Ki Bari (This is a smallornamental garden which was a popular relaxing spot for the royal ladies came for a stroll and hence the name) and Jagdish Temple (Built in 1651 by Maharana Jagat Singh, it is an impressive, beautifully proportioned structure, covered with carved friezes and heavily decorated inside). Evening boat ride on Lake Pichola. Night stay in your hotel.

Day 12 : Ranakpur Excursionand flight to Jaipur
Heritage Art work in Ranakpur Temple Tour !!!This morning after breakfast we take you to the finest temples of Ranakpur (Located 90 Kms out of Udaipur city, Ranakpur in Rajasthan is an exceptionally beautiful temple complex in the Aravali ranges. Built in the reign of one of the liberal and gifted monarchs Rana Kumbha, these temples are a unique example of Jain ecclesiastical architecture and are one of the five most important pilgrimage sites of Jainism). Later in the afternoon drive back to Udaipur to check out from your hotel. You will be transfer to the airport in the evening to board your flight to Jaipur (Jaipur is the vibrant capital of Rajasthan, is popularly known as the "Pink City" because of the pink-coloured buildings and houses in its old city. Surrounded by barren hills surmounted by forts and crenellated walls. The city owes its name, its foundation and its careful planning to the great warrior-as-tronomer Maharaja Jai Singh II.). Airport transfer and hotel stay in Jaipur.

Day 13 : Jaipur Sightseeing
After breakfast we start the tour with an excursion to Amer Fort (Situated a top the Aravali hills Amer is the ancient capital of Jaipur and a magnificent example of Rajput architecture).We ascend to the fort on Elephant's back. Later we also visit the Jaigarh Fort where the largest canon of the world is in display for the visitors. In the afternoon visit Hawa Mahal - Palace of Winds (This five storied building which looks out over the main street of the old city is one of Jaipur's major landmarks. This is a stunning example of the Rajput artistry with it'spink, semi-octagonal and delicately honey combed sand stone windows. Originally Hawa Mahal was built to enable the ladies of the royal families to watch the every day life and processions of the city), Jantar Mantar - The Observatory (The Observatory, built by Raja Jai Singh in 1728. It is an excellent example of the marvelous precision where in each construction has as pecific purpose to measure the position of stars, altitudes and azimuths or calculating eclipses. The most striking instrument is the Sun Dial which is 90 feet high) and City Palace Museum (City Palace is delightful blend of Mughal and traditional Rajasthani architecture. A part of the palace is still the house of the former Maharaja of Jaipur). Night stay in the hotel.

Day14 : Jaipur - Agra
Breakfast in the hotel and then drive to Agra (Agra attained its Mugal Architecture Fatehpur Sikri Agra !!!magnificence under the Emperor Akbar The Great. Once the capital of Mughal India, it is famous for the world renowned Taj Mahal). Enroute visit Fatehpur Sikri (This magnificent fortified ghost citywas the capital of Mughal empire between 1571 and 1585, during the reign of Emperor Akbar. It was built by the emperor to commemorate the birth of hisson Jahangir. Fatehpur Sikri was there after quickly abandoned, but till dateit remains a perfectly preserved example of Mughal architecture.). Later proceed to Agra and check into the hotel. Afternoon visit Taj Mahal which is perhaps the most beautiful monument ever built in the history of love. Also visit the Agra Fort (In Akbar's time the fort was principally a military structure but by Shah Jahan's time it had partially become a palace. This fort serves as vantage location to have the fabulous glimpse of The Taj Mahal.). Night stay in your hotel at Agra.

Day 15 : Agra - Gwalior (120 kms)
After breakfast we transfer you to the railway station to board an Express train to Jhansi. Arrive Jhansi and meet with our representative for transfer to Khajuraho ex Orchha Fort (Orchha asmall village has its important due to the Fort and Temples. It is an architectural conception of unusual vigour and intricate sophistication). Check into the hotel at Khajuraho in the afternoon and later visit the temples of Khajuraho (The Khajuraho temples are famous not only for their symmetry and design but also for intricate and erotic carvings on their Kamasutra temples - Khajurahowalls). Night stay will be in the hotel.

Day 16 : Khajuraho - Jhansi - Delhi by Express Train journey
After breakfast visit the other parts of Khajuraho temples (The temples are divided into three main geographical groups viz. the Western, Eastern and Southern). Later drive to Jhansi railway station to board train to Delhi. Arrive Delhi late evening and you will be then transferred to your hotel for night stay.

Day 17 : Delhi sightseeing
After breakfast a full day guided tour of Old and New Delhi (Delhi, the capital of India comprises ofconspicuously contrasting Old and New Delhi. Old Delhi was the capital of Muslim India between the 12th and 19th centuries and one can find mosques, monuments and forts related to Muslim history. New Delhi is the imperial city created asIndia's capital by the British, intricately planned and comprises of imposing buildings displaying various modern style of architecture) wil ltake you to Red Fort (Built by the builder of the Taj Mahal - Shah Jehan,famous for its delicately carved inlaid and Royal chambers),Raj Ghat (Thecreamation Ground of Humayun's Tomb Delhi !!!the father of the Nation Mahatma Gandhi), Humayun's Tomb (Humayun's tomb is believed to have been designed in 1565 AD by the widow of Mughal emperor Himayun. It's plan, based on the description of Islamic paradise gardens, is known to have inspired the Taj Mahal and many later Mughal tombs. This type of garden is known as a charbagh and is basedon a grid),Safdarjung's Tomb (Representing the last phase of the Mughal style of architecture, Safdarjang's Tomb stands in the centre of an extensive garden), Qutab Minar (73 meters high which tapers from a 15 mdiameter base to just 2.5 m at the top. The walls consist intricately carved quotations from Koran and is one of the most perfect towers of the Persianworld) Drive through India Gate (The war memorial) and President's Palace. Night stay in your hotel.

Day 18 : Leave Delhi
The representative of Max Holidays will ensure timely transfer for you to the airport to board your onward flight.

Boasting a lively pantheon of deities that smile from exquisitely sculpted temple gopura, the Hindu religion absorbs beliefs and philosophies from all over, thus practices frequently differ from place to place. Nevertheless the basic tenets of Hinduism were laid out in the Vedas, and describe the goal of uniting with Brahma, the creator, via a life of asceticism and meditation. Hindu belief includes the concept of samsara, the cycle of death and rebirth, and release from samsara, or moksha.Muslims are a significant ten percent of the population, and all over India, mosques are almost as ubiquitous as temple. Islam worships one God, Allah, eschews pork, and Muslim women are encouraged to veil themselves.
